Austrian defence technology company Schiebel has unveiled two new products – the Camcopter S-101 and Camcopter S-301 – marking the next generation of unmanned helicopter systems purpose-built for military operations.
Building on the global success of the proven Camcopter S-100, which has seen widespread service with armies and navies worldwide, the new armed variants introduce enhanced capability for precision strike missions.
According to Schiebel, the S-101 and S-301 platforms represent a significant evolution in tactical unmanned air systems (UAS), featuring advanced performance, military-grade systems integration, embedded artificial intelligence and a robust design tailored for demanding, multi-domain operations.
Both models are engineered to operate effectively in contested electromagnetic environments, ensuring resilience even under the most challenging conditions.
The new systems are being developed and manufactured by Schiebel Defence GmbH, a recently established subsidiary based in Wiener Neustadt, Austria, dedicated exclusively to armed UAS.
The platforms are designed around the integration of existing missile and rocket systems suitable for rotary-wing aircraft, offering persistent and distributed lethality with the ability to engage targets at stand-off ranges.
Schiebel said the creation of the subsidiary and the launch of the armed Camcopter platforms reflect a direct response to shifting global security dynamics and increasing demand for weaponised autonomous systems.
